scrappiness
scrap·pi·ness
noun \ˈskra-pē-nəs\Definition of SCRAPPINESS
: the quality or state of being scrappy
Examples of SCRAPPINESS
- <his natural scrappiness serves him well as an aggressive defense attorney>
First Known Use of SCRAPPINESS
1867
